Lasting Advantages of Nomadic Housing




The means we think of home is altering. As climate concerns intensify and an expanding variety of individuals question the environmental impact of standard living, nomadic housing is quietly becoming among the much more compelling answers to a really contemporary issue. Far from being an edge way of life choice, nomadic housing-- incorporating whatever from tiny homes on wheels and transformed vans to drifting houseboats and modular micro-dwellings-- provides a surprisingly abundant set of sustainability benefits that are entitled to severe interest.

A Smaller Sized Impact, Literally and Figuratively


One of the most instant environmental benefit of nomadic real estate is scale. A regular country home in India or the West occupies thousands of square metres and demands enormous quantities of material to construct-- concrete, steel, lumber, glass-- all of which carry substantial carbon expenses before a solitary resident moves in.
Nomadic residences, by contrast, are made with extreme efficiency in mind. A strong small home or transformed automobile might utilize a fraction of the products while still offering every little thing a person truly needs. Much less area means much less stuff, and less things indicates less resources removed, fewer items produced, and much less waste ultimately thrown out.
This downsizing impact surges outside. Smaller sized living spaces normally discourage overconsumption. When every square centimetre matters, residents end up being deeply willful regarding what they possess, what they utilize, and what they absolutely need. That change in frame of mind is itself a sustainability win.

Power Consumption Reimagined


Off-Grid Abilities


Among the most amazing sustainability dimensions of nomadic housing is its compatibility with off-grid power systems. Because nomadic houses are compact and self-contained, they are excellent candidates for photovoltaic panels, tiny wind turbines, and battery storage space setups. Numerous van-lifers and little home dwellers produce all the power they need from a moderate roof solar array-- something practically difficult to attain at the scale of a traditional house.
This independence from the grid doesn't simply lower electrical power expenses. It lowers reliance on fossil-fuel-heavy power facilities and gets rid of the resident totally from the inefficiencies of centralised energy circulation.

Reliable Heating and Cooling


Heating and cooling down a huge home is one of the most significant factors to household carbon emissions. A nomadic dwelling, with its small quantity and attentively shielded shell, requires considerably much less energy to maintain a comfortable temperature level. Several nomadic homeowners supplement with wood-burning micro-stoves or passive solar style, reducing their home heating needs to near zero in mild climates.
Similarly crucial, nomadic homeowners can merely move with the seasons-- heading to warmer regions in wintertime and cooler altitudes in summer season-- effectively using location itself as an environment control system.

Water Usage and Waste Decrease


Conscious Water Intake


Staying in a nomadic home adjustments your partnership with water. When your supply originates from a tank you fill manually or a rainwater harvesting system you preserve yourself, every litre feels priceless. Nomadic dwellers continually report using much much less water than the average house-- not through starvation, but with recognition and smart style.
Low-flow components, composting toilets, greywater recycling systems, and completely dry composting choices are basic functions in properly designed nomadic homes. These technologies, while offered to standard homeowners, are much more generally adopted in nomadic communities because necessity drives technology.

Waste That Goes No Place Beneficial in a Fixed Home


Composting commodes are entitled to specific mention. By converting human waste into useful garden compost as opposed to flushing it right into water treatment systems, nomadic homes close a biological loophole that standard pipes leaves permanently open. The environmental savings-- in water, in power, in chemical therapy-- are considerable over a lifetime of use.
